A fish fry fundraiser hosted by the Royal Canadian Legion Branch #42 in Selkirk, Manitoba, has officially sold out ahead of its event on March 28, 2026. The dinner begins at 6:00 PM at the branch located at 403 Eveline Street and serves as both a social gathering and a way to raise money for local programs. Because all tickets have been sold, organizers are highlighting the strong interest from the community.

The Royal Canadian Legion is the largest organization in the country dedicated to supporting veterans, including former members of the military and the RCMP. This branch in Selkirk uses the proceeds from regular meals like this fish fry to fund services for veterans and their families. The organization has been operating in the region since it was first founded in Winnipeg in November 1925.

Local residents found out about the fundraiser through community forums like the Around and About Selkirk, MB Facebook group. The city is home to about 10,504 residents in the Interlake region who regularly support these veteran-led initiatives. Those who missed out on tickets for this weekend may need to watch for future event dates hosted at the branch hall.
